Understanding Anemia and Its Causes

Anemia is a condition characterized by a deficiency in red blood cells or hemoglobin, leading to reduced oxygen flow to the body's organs. The most common form, iron-deficiency anemia, results from insufficient iron. However, other nutritional shortfalls, particularly of vitamin B12 and folate, can also impair red blood cell production.

While fasting itself is not a direct cause of anemia, certain fasting practices can increase the risk of developing it. The primary concern is not the temporary absence of food but the cumulative effect of a restricted diet over time, which can lead to deficiencies in the key nutrients needed for healthy blood.

The Direct Nutritional Link to Anemia

During prolonged periods of not eating, the body relies on its stored energy and nutrients. If refeeding periods do not replenish these stores effectively with nutrient-dense foods, deficiencies can occur. For individuals already at risk, such as menstruating women, pregnant individuals, or those with underlying health issues, the risk is higher.

  • Iron: Iron is a critical component of hemoglobin. A lack of sufficient iron intake over time will directly impact the body's ability to produce adequate hemoglobin, causing iron-deficiency anemia. Restrictive diets often lead to lower overall iron intake. Furthermore, certain substances found in common beverages like tea and coffee, if consumed too close to meals, can inhibit iron absorption.
  • Vitamin B12 and Folate: These B vitamins are essential for the maturation of red blood cells. Without enough of them, the body may produce abnormally large, immature red blood cells, a condition known as megaloblastic anemia. Prolonged fasting can reduce the intake of B12 and folate, with some studies confirming deficiencies in individuals on restrictive diets.
  • Other Micronutrients: Fasting can also affect other minerals vital for blood health. For example, zinc and magnesium losses have been observed in some starvation studies, though more research is needed to fully understand their impact on anemia.

Factors That Increase Anemia Risk

Certain individuals and fasting patterns are more susceptible to developing anemia. Awareness of these risk factors is the first step toward safe practice.

  • Duration and Frequency: The longer and more frequent the fast, the higher the risk of nutritional deficiencies. An individual practicing a 24-hour fast once a week is at a lower risk than someone on a multi-day or weeks-long water fast.
  • Pre-existing Conditions: People with conditions like inflammatory bowel disease (IBD) or celiac disease, which impair nutrient absorption, are at a higher risk. Similarly, individuals with impaired fasting glucose have been shown to have an increased incidence of anemia.
  • Menstruation: Women who menstruate are already at a higher risk of iron-deficiency anemia due to blood loss and should be particularly cautious with restrictive fasting.
  • Poor Dietary Choices: If the non-fasting periods are filled with highly processed, low-nutrient foods, the body's stores will not be adequately replenished, increasing the risk of deficiency.

How to Fast Safely to Prevent Anemia

To minimize the risk of anemia while fasting, a proactive approach to nutrition is essential.

Prioritize Nutrient-Dense Foods

  • Consume iron-rich foods, including both heme (red meat, poultry, fish) and non-heme (lentils, spinach, fortified cereals) sources.
  • Ensure adequate intake of B12 through animal products or fortified foods. Vegetarians and vegans must be especially vigilant.
  • Pair iron-rich meals with vitamin C sources (e.g., citrus fruits, tomatoes, broccoli) to significantly enhance non-heme iron absorption.

Smart Hydration and Supplementation

  • Stay well-hydrated, focusing on water and electrolyte-rich fluids like coconut water during your eating window.
  • Avoid drinking caffeinated beverages like tea and coffee with or immediately after meals, as they can inhibit iron absorption.
  • Consider supplementation, especially if your diet is restrictive. However, consult a doctor first, as blood work is needed to identify specific deficiencies.

Listen to Your Body

  • Pay close attention to symptoms like fatigue, dizziness, weakness, or pale skin, which could indicate anemia.
  • Never force a fast, especially if you feel unwell. Anemia can be exacerbated by fasting and may require ending the fast immediately.
